ABSTRACT This paper presents the results of a study of a sample of 609 English teachers and school executive (headteachers, deputies, etc.). The study sought to examine and benchmark teachers’ occupational motivation, satisfaction and health and to test a model of teacher satisfaction developed in Australia in a previous research phase.

English teachers were found, in common with their Australian counterparts, to be motivated most strongly by altruism, affiliation and personal growth. They were also found, again like Australian teachers, to be most satisfied with ‘core business’ aspects of teaching‐‐facilitating student learning and achievement, developing as a professional and working with other staff; and the least satisfied with matters from systemic and societal levels‐‐the nature and pace of educational change, and the status and image of teaching. Between these two domains lay factors specific to particular schools: school leadership and communication, school resources and relationships with community.

Teachers from different types of schools and those holding different promotion positions were found to differ on some measures of satisfaction; however, unlike Australian principals, headteachers were found to be, on the whole, no more satisfied than their classroom teacher colleagues and to be similarly ‘stressed’. These findings are interpreted in the light of the specific context of the English education system.  相似文献

Purpose: In this article the use of blended learning multimedia materials as an education tool was compared with the traditional approach for skills training.

Design/Methodology/Approach: This study was conducted in Ireland using a pre-test, post-test experimental design. All students were instructed on how to complete two skills using either a traditional or blended methodology. They were subsequently assessed to determine their ability to perform the practical skills.

Findings: The findings stressed the suitability of blended learning not only when it was found that there was no significant difference between method of teaching and skill acquisition but also when it was revealed that student demographics had no major influence on skill acquisition.

Practical Implications: It can be concluded that blended learning can be used effectively for the instruction of a diverse range of practical skills in agricultural college and benefit in the successful knowledge transfer to a growing and diverse student population with more emphasis placed on the students taking charge of their own learning environment.

Originality/Value: The article demonstrates the value of blended learning as a successful medium for practical skill attainment within the agricultural college environment.

The dearth of behaviour modification research carried out in secondary school situations is recognised and an emphasis on ‘heavy’ behavioural interventions in both North America and UK research literature is identified. Additionally attention is drawn to a lack of repeated replication studies in single‐case experimental design in general‐‐a shortcoming that reduces the case for claiming generalisability of findings of many research outcomes.

This paper reports the effects on Secondary school classroom on‐task behaviour of a number of ‘light’ behavioural interventions. Six whole class studies are reported. Increase in pupil on‐task behaviour resulted in three cases‐‐though in one situation a return to baseline phase was not attempted. In two further cases inconclusive outcomes resulted and the reasons for this are discussed. In one case initial levels of on‐task behaviour were so high that little room for improvement was possible.

The lack of demonstration of the effect of the interventions on any individual pupil's behaviour is recognised, although positive outcome data for one pupil are reported.

The conclusion is drawn that ‘light’ behavioural strategies can effect change in the behaviour of secondary aged pupils in a positive direction.  相似文献

Background Global climate change (GCC) has become one of the most debated socio-scientific issues after an increase in media attention. Recently, there have also been several studies describing students’ and teachers’ alternative conceptions about GCC. Therefore, designing learning environments at the college level that focus on accurate conceptions of GCC has become important in order for pre-service teachers to correct their alternative conceptions. There are, however, a limited number of studies that aim to both increase pre-service teachers’ knowledge about these issues and explore their perceptions of teaching this subject.

Purpose The purpose of this study was to investigate the effects of inquiry-based activities on pre-service teachers’ knowledge about GCC and their perceptions of teaching this subject.

Sample The participants were 102 pre-service middle school mathematics and science teachers who were enrolled in an environmental education course.

Design and methods A one group pre-test–post-test design was employed to identify changes after pre-service teachers engaged in a learning unit on GCC. The inquiry-based GCC unit was implemented during the spring semester at a public university in northeastern Turkey. The unit was implemented over seven sessions. Data were collected through two questionnaires: the ‘GCC content questionnaire’ and the ‘perceptions of teaching GCC questionnaire’. Each questionnaire was administered both before and after implementation of the unit. Content questionnaire responses were analyzed using a paired-samples t-test. Responses to the perceptions of teaching questionnaire were analyzed using inductive open coding.

Results Results indicated that after the implementation the pre-service teachers significantly improved their understanding of GCC across all items in the content questionnaire, saw several benefits of and challenges about teaching GCC, and perceived themselves as better prepared to teach about GCC in their future classrooms.

Conclusions Teacher education programs should integrate inquiry-based GCC instruction to increase pre-service teachers’ knowledge as well as their preparedness to teach about this important planetary issue.  相似文献

Background: Technological pedagogical content knowledge (TPACK) is critical for effective teaching with technology. However, generally science teacher education programs do not help pre-service teachers develop TPACK.

Purpose: The purpose of this study was to assess pre-service science teachers' TPACK over a semester-long Science Methods.

Sample: Twenty-seven pre-service science teachers took the course toward the end of their four-year teacher education program.

Design and method: The study employed the case study methodology. Lesson plans and microteaching observations were used as data collection tools. Technological Pedagogical Content Knowledge-based lesson plan assessment instrument (TPACK-LpAI) and Technological Pedagogical Content Knowledge Observation Protocol (TPACK-OP) were used to analyze data obtained from observations and lesson plans.

Results: The results showed that the TPACK-focused Science Methods course had an impact on pre-service teachers’ TPACK to varying degrees. Most importantly, the course helped teachers gain knowledge of effective usage of educational technology tools.

Conclusion: Teacher education programs should provide opportunities to pre-service teachers to develop their TPACK so that they can effectively integrate technology into their teaching.  相似文献

Background: From previous research among science teachers it is known that teachers’ attitudes to their subjects affect important aspects of their teaching, including their confidence and the amount of time they spend teaching the subject. In contrast, less is known about technology teachers’ attitudes.

Purpose: Therefore, the aim of this study is to investigate Swedish technology teachers’ attitudes toward their subject, and how these attitudes may be related to background variables.

Sample: Technology teachers in Swedish compulsory schools (n = 1153) responded to a questionnaire about teachers’ attitudes, experiences, and background.

Methods: Exploratory factor analysis was used to inwvestigate attitude dimensions of the questionnaire. Groupings of teachers based on attitudes were identified through cluster analysis, and multinomial logistic regression was performed to investigate the role of teachers’ background variables as predictors for cluster belonging.

Results: Four attitudinal dimensions were identified in the questionnaire, corresponding to distinct components of attitudes. Three teacher clusters were identified among the respondents characterized by positive, negative, and mixed attitudes toward the subject of technology and its teaching, respectively. The most influential predictors of cluster membership were to be qualified for teaching technology, having participated in in-service-training, teaching at a school with a proper overall teaching plan for the subject of technology and teaching at a school with a defined number of teaching hours for the subject.

Conclusions: The results suggest that efforts to increase technology teachers’ qualifications and establishing a fixed number of teaching hours and an overall teaching plan for the subject of technology may yield more positive attitudes among teachers toward technology teaching. In turn, this could improve the status of the subject as well as students’ learning.  相似文献

On defining distance education   总被引:1,自引:0,他引:1  
Four generally accepted definitions of distance education are analysed and from them six components of a comprehensive definition are chosen. The forms of education that are considered to fall within the concept of distance education as outlined are considered from the point of view of choice of medium, institutional type and didactic model. Various forms of education that bear some similarities to distance education but are not to be identified with it are described. The term ‘distance education’ is proposed as the most satisfactory solution to the problem of terminology.

The term ‘distance education’ covers the various forms of study at all levels which are not under the continuous, immediate supervision of tutors present with their students in lecture rooms or on the same premises, but which, nevertheless, benefit from the planning, guidance and tuition of a tutorial organisation.

(Holmberg,1977:9)

Distance education is education which either does not imply the physical presence of the teacher appointed to dispense it in the place where it is received or in which the teacher is present only on occasion or for selected tasks.

(Loi 71.556 du 12 juillet 1971)

Distance teaching/education (Fernunterricht) is a method of imparting knowledge, skills and attitudes which is rationalised by the application of division of labour and organisational principles as well as by the extensive use of technical media, especially for the purpose of reproducing high quality teaching material which makes it possible to instruct great numbers of students at the same time wherever they live. It is an industrialised form of teaching and learning.

(Peters, 1973:206)

Distance teaching may be defined as the family of instructional methods in which the teaching behaviours are executed apart from the learning behaviours, including those that in a contiguous situation would be performed in the learner's presence, so that communication between the teacher and the learner must be facilitated by print, electronic, mechanical or other devices.

(Moore, 1973:664)  相似文献

Background: This study is the second study of a design-based research, organised around four studies, that aims to improve student learning, teaching skills and teacher training concerning the design-based learning approach called Learning by Design (LBD).

Purpose: LBD uses the context of design challenges to learn, among other things, science. Previous research shows that this approach to subject integration is quite successful but provides little profit on (scientific) concept learning. For this, a lack of (knowledge of) proper teaching strategies is suggested as an important reason. This study explores these strategies and more specific the interaction with concept learning.

Sample: Six Dutch first-year bachelor’s degree science student teachers, between the ages of 16 and 18, and two science teacher trainers (principal investigators included) were involved.

Design and methods: A mixed methods study was used to study LBD’s teaching practice in depth. Based on a theoretical framework of (concept) learning-related teaching strategies video recordings of a guided LBD challenge were analysed to unravel teacher handling in detail. Complemented by questionnaire and interview data and students’ learning outcomes (pre- and post-exam) the effectiveness of teaching strategies was established and shortcomings were distracted.

Results: Students reached medium overall learning gains where the highest gains were strongly task-related. Teacher handling was dominated by providing feedback and stimulating collaboration and only 13% of all teacher interventions concerned direct explication of underlying science. And especially these explicit teaching strategies were highly appreciated by students to learn about science.

Conclusions: In accordance with insights about knowledge transfer, LBD needs to be enriched with explicit teaching strategies, interludes according to poor-related science content important for cohesive understanding and de- and recontextualisation of concepts for deeper understanding.  相似文献

Background: In developed countries, it is challenging for teachers to select pedagogical practices that encourage students to enrol in science and technology courses in upper secondary school.

Purpose: Aiming to understand the enrolment dynamics, this study analyses sample-based data from Finland’s National Assessment in Science to determine whether pedagogical approaches influence student intention to enrol in upper secondary school physics courses.

Sample: This study examined a clustered sample of 2949 Finnish students in the final year of comprehensive school (15–16 years old).

Methods: Through explorative factor analysis, we extracted several variables that were expected to influence student intention to enrol in physics courses. We applied partial correlation to determine the underlying interdependencies of the variables.

Results: The analysis revealed that the main predictor of enrolment in upper secondary school physics courses is whether students feel that physics is important. Although statistically significant, partial correlations between variables were rather small. However, the analysis of partial correlations revealed that pedagogical practices influence inquiry and attitudinal factors. Pedagogical practices that emphasise science experimentation and the social construction of knowledge had the strongest influence.

Conclusions: The research implies that to increase student enrolment in physics courses, the way students interpret the subject’s importance needs to be addressed, which can be done by the pedagogical practices of discussion, teacher demonstrations, and practical work.  相似文献

Purpose: This study examines how different purposes can support teachers in their work with progressions as a part of a teaching sequences in science in primary school.

Design/Method: The study was carried out in two classes working with inquiry and the events that took place in the classroom were filmed. In the study, we have chosen to use the technical term proximate purposes for the student-oriented purposes, and ultimate purposes for the scientific purposes. Together, these two types of purposes form the organisational purposes for the classes. Proximate purposes work in such a way that students can use their language and relate to their experiences as ends-in-view. To examine how organising purposes can be used to analyse progressions, we discuss examples from two different lessons.

Result: The study shows the importance of proximate purposes working as ends-in-view and also demonstrates how the teacher and students may create continuity in teaching to enable progression as a part of a teaching sequence.

Conclusions: To create continuity, it was essential that the teacher scaffolded the students in ways which allowed the students to explicitly differentiate between what was relevant or not, about the proximate purposes in relation to the ultimate purpose.  相似文献

Background: One of the topics students have difficulties in understanding is electromagnetic induction. Active learning methods instead of traditional learning method may be able to help facilitate students’ understanding such topics more effectively.

Purpose: The study investigated the effectiveness of physical models and simulations on students’ understanding daily life applications of electromagnetic induction.

Sample: The nine participants in the study were voluntaries from the fourth year of the physics education undergraduate programme.

Design and methods: Lessons were designed to enhance students’ conceptual understanding of electromagnetic induction. Researchers developed multiple generator and simple electric motor models. These models and simulations about Faraday’s Law, magnetic field, magnets, generator and radio waves were used in lessons. The data were collected through open-ended questionnaire and semi-structured interview. Open-ended questionnaire was employed in a pre-test and a post-test. Students’ answers were categorized as sound understanding, partial understanding, misunderstanding and no understanding. At the end of the last lesson, the interview was implemented about the students’ opinions related to application.

Results: For each question, the number of responses matching the accepted scientific explanation increased after application. The number of illogical or incorrect responses decreased.

Conclusions: Physical models and simulations used in the present study had positive effect on students participated in this study to understand electromagnetic induction and its daily life applications.  相似文献

Abstract Verbal self‐instruction training (VSIT) was seen as one possible solution to the problem of obtaining more efficient procedures for the teaching of the retarded. Thus, VSIT was compared to the more commonly used modelling and imitation (MODIM) procedures with a moderately‐severely mentally retarded sample of 48 adult men from an institution in a rural setting. Feedback regarding performance was also added to these conditions to investigate its effect on generalisation outcomes, thus giving four training packages: VSIT; VSIT with feedback MODIM; and MODIM with feedback.

Six independent living tasks were trained (two sandwich making, two vacuuming and two collating): three being used for initial training and three as related or ‘near generalisation’ tasks.

The four instructional packages were investigated in order to ascertain their relative efficiency in terms of (trainer) effort required to train to criterion on the six tasks and the achievement of generalisation and maintenance outcomes.

It was found that VSIT was an efficient alternative to MODIM for enhancing acquisition on five out of the six trained tasks (the exception being initial acquisition of the sandwich making task). Moreover, as indicated by reduction in training effort required for the generalisation tasks, the VSIT groups achieved greater savings on the sandwich making and vacuuming tasks. VSIT was also found to generate significantly better short and long‐term maintenance of skills on all three initial training tasks.

A differential task effect was noted with the feedback conditions (VSIT with feedback, and MODIM with feedback), whereby the performances of VSIT subjects on both the training and generalisation sandwich making tasks, and performances of MODIM subjects on the sandwich making generalisation task, were benefited by the addition of this condition; although feedback was found to exert no consistent influence on performances of subjects in either VSIT or MODIM groups on the vacuuming and collating tasks.

The data are discussed with reference to other studies in this area, it being concluded that VSIT is a promising method of instruction for MR populations.  相似文献

Co-teaching has gained considerable interest as a means of promoting the inclusion of students with disabilities in mainstream education. Nowadays, there is a consensus among researchers that co-teaching should provide effective education to all students in a mainstream class. This study aims to explore co-teachers’ attitudes towards co-teaching responsibilities in Greek mainstream classrooms. In particular, it examines co-teachers’ attitudes with regard to their non-class-time (planning and evaluation) and class-time (instruction and behaviour management) responsibilities for students with and without disabilities. Four hundred co-teachers participated in this survey study. Overall, our findings demonstrate that mainstream education teachers and special education teachers disagree about their respective class-time and non-class-time responsibilities, and that their role influences their attitudes towards these responsibilities. The study concludes that the different attitudes of co-teachers towards their responsibilities could hinder the development of a shared approach in teaching students with and without disabilities in inclusive classrooms.

The paper considers aberrant behaviour in the context of cognitive style with reference to both diagnosis and treatment.

Aims.

The aims of the study were to investigate whether the style of pupils with behaviour problems was different from that of children with no reported problems, and also to consider how pupils of different style manifested their problem behaviours.

Sample.

The sample comprised 83 male pupils aged 10‐18 years from two residential special schools.

Method.

The sample were given the Cognitive Styles Analysis to assess their positions on the Wholist‐Analytic and Verbal‐Imagery style dimensions. The pupil records of the special school pupils who were at the extreme of the style dimensions were also examined.

Results.

When their style characteristics were contrasted with a Comparison Sample of 413 12‐16‐year‐old males attending 10 secondary schools, the special school pupils had a significantly higher proportion of both Wholists and Verbalisers, than the Comparison Group. Further, the inspection of the records indicated that the types of social behaviour and behaviour problems exhibited varied with style, and particularly on the Wholist‐Analytic dimension.

Conclusion.

The results were considered to have implications for the origins and treatment of problem behaviour.  相似文献

Background: Enhancing students’ metacognitive abilities will help to facilitate their understanding of science concepts.

Purpose: The study was designed to conduct and evaluate the effectiveness of a repertoire of interventions aimed at enhancing secondary school students’ metacognitive capabilities and their achievements in science.

Sample: A class of 35 Year 9 students participated in the study.

Design and methods: The study involved a pre-post design, conducted by the first author as part of the regular designated science programme in a class taught by him.

In order to enhance the students’ metacognitive capabilities, the first author employed clearly stated focused outcomes, engaging them in collaborative group work, reading scientific texts and using concept mapping techniques during classroom instruction. The data to evaluate the effectiveness of the metacognitive interventions were obtained from pre- and post-test results of two metacognitive questionnaires, the Metacognitive Support Questionnaire (MSpQ) and the Metacognitive Strategies Questionnaire (MStQ), and data from interviews. In addition, pre-test and post-test scores were used from a two-tier multiple-choice test on Light.

Results: The results showed gains in the MSpQ but not in the MStQ. However, the qualitative data from interviews suggested high metacognitive capabilities amongst the high- and average-achieving students at the end of the study. Students gains were also evident from the test scores in the Light test.

Conclusion: Although the quantitative data obtained from the Metacognitive Strategies Questionnaire did not show significant gains in the students’ metacognitive strategies, the qualitative data from interviews suggested positive perceptions of students’ metacognitive strategies amongst the high- and average-achieving students. Data from the Metacognitive Support Questionnaire showed that there were significant gains in the students’ perceptions of their metacognitive support implying that the majority of the students perceived that their learning environment was oriented towards the development of their metacognitive capabilities. The effect of the metacognitive interventions on students’ achievement in the Light test resulted in students displaying the correct declarative knowledge, but quite often they lacked the procedural knowledge by failing to explain their answers correctly.  相似文献

Purpose: This paper explores the interaction between extension services and gender relations in order to suggest ways and strategies that can be useful in ensuring that extension services are gender-equitable and empowering for women.

Design/Methodology/Approach:In total, 35 sex-disaggregated focus group discussions with farmers, and 4 interviews with extension officers were conducted in Dedza and Ntcheu districts. Data on the type of training offered, training participants recruitment methods, as well as data on barriers to and opportunities for training were collected. A social relations approach, focusing on gender relations, was used to analyse the data.

Findings:Underlying gender norms and cultural norms mediate access to information. For instance, some men regard themselves as representatives of their households during training and, to some extent, extension officers reinforce these views by using biased training recruitment methods. Gender norms related to household decision-making impact on the ability of women to access training opportunities.

Practical implications: Agricultural extension should not be a purely technical programme focusing only on good agricultural practices. It should also embed modules aimed at addressing social practices that disadvantage some people, particularly women, as well as adopt gender sensitive recruitment methods that do not rely on male-biased recruitment channels.

Originality/Value:The social relations approach used, focusing on gender relations, is aimed at trying to come up with the conditions necessary for agricultural training to be empowering for women. This paper is therefore of interest to extension agents and other development practitioners interested in women’s empowerment and the transformation of gender relations.  相似文献
